Output 4b368b53ee99523748019c705b610be5ccc57e0d5a30d37d4c2c3878cee19592:3

value
28874503
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c0ae0a558ae9bfdb993f256472c24a851d69609 OP_EQUAL
address
MLfds51iFVHEKyBk4jgxqgtYUn4D19g7VD
transaction
4b368b53ee99523748019c705b610be5ccc57e0d5a30d37d4c2c3878cee19592
spent
true